Y.E.S. House Foundation History

  • 2002
    Youth Emergency Services Foundation was created in 2001 to serve as the donor’s hands, reaching out to our kids and their families by providing resources for the Y.E.S. House that would not be available otherwise.
  • 2003
    Incorporated with the Secretary of State as a 501c3
  • 2005
    City Donated Land
  • 2008
    The Crisis Shelter was completed in February 2008, followed by the Boys Residential Treatment Center in March of 2008.
  • 2011
    The Tammy Hladky Center of Hope hosues the school, administrative offices and counseling center. A $500,000 donation was made by the Haldky family in memory of Tammy Hladky, who passed away in June 1995. The remaining funds were raised through grants and private donations.
  • 2015
    Girls Cottage / Campus Complete

YES House Operations have been serving children and families since 1976. The YES HouseFoundation is here to support YES House and their activities.
